|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: Front coil spring broke on my 1999 ford taurus. i was told by the tow driver it was a recall issue with the model. i checked on ford's web site and sure enough it was. ford agreed to fix the coil, but not the tire it punctured. they say i was informed by mail, although i never received any notice. i take my car in for regular service 4-5 x per year and was never, not even once, told they could do the recall at no charge while my car was there. i have not received their recall notice, possibly because i have moved 2x since buying the car. they were notified of my address change each time i moved. *jb |
